Kinds Of Honda Keys
Honda uses numerous types of keys for their cars, each serving a various purpose and including different technologies. Here's a breakdown of the various types:
Type of KeyDescriptionNotesStandard KeyA standard metal key utilized for manual locks and ignition.Frequently found in older Honda models.Transponder KeyIncludes a chip that interacts with the car's immobilizer system for security.Needs programs to work with the car.Keyless Entry KeyFunctions buttons to lock/unlock doors and begin the automobile without inserting a key.Usually consists of transponder technology.Smart KeyUtilizes innovative innovation for keyless entry and ignition (push-to-start systems).May likewise have additional features like remote start.Overview of Honda Key Technologies
The advancement of key technology in [Honda Lost Key Replacement](http://124.223.89.168:8080/car-key-replacement-honda8918) automobiles shows the brand's commitment to security and benefit. Below is a more detailed take a look at each type of key:

Standard Key: The simplest key type, it enables for manual locking and starting of the automobile. Suitable for older designs, they are simple to replace but may lack innovative security features.

Transponder Key: This key has an integrated chip that produces a special signal to the car's ignition system. If the signal isn't acknowledged, the car won't start-- supplying an extra layer of security versus theft.

Keyless Entry Key: Using radio frequency, these keys enable the chauffeur to unlock doors or trunk from a distance. They are more convenient than basic keys and are frequently used in more recent Honda models.

Smart Key: The pinnacle of benefit, clever keys enable you to just have the key fob in your pocket while you approach the lorry. The engine starts with the push of a button, and the doors unlock immediately as you get close.
How to Get a Spare Key for Your HondaAction 1: Identify Your Key Type
Before you can make a spare key, you need to know what kind of key you currently have. Refer to the table above to see which type uses to your automobile. This decision will affect the replacement procedure, consisting of cost and area.
Step 2: Gather Necessary Information
To have a spare key made, you'll normally require to offer the following:
Vehicle Identification Number (VIN): This can typically be found on your car's dashboard or in the owner's manual.Evidence of Ownership: Documentation such as your motorist's license and lorry registration.Existing Key: If you have a spare key, bring it along, as some types can be replicated more quickly.Action 3: Visit a Locksmith or Honda Dealer

The cost of getting a spare key varies based on your key type and where you choose the service. Here's a basic prices standard:
Key TypeCost at DealershipCost at LocksmithBasic Key₤ 10 - ₤ 30₤ 5 - ₤ 15Transponder Key₤ 40 - ₤ 150₤ 30 - ₤ 100Keyless Entry Key₤ 50 - ₤ 200₤ 40 - ₤ 120Smart Key₤ 200 - ₤ 400₤ 150 - ₤ 300Regularly Asked Questions1. Can I get a spare key without the initial?
It is possible, however likely more complicated. Depending upon the car's condition and key type, a locksmith professional or dealership may have the ability to develop a new key utilizing the VIN.
2. How long does it take to get a spare key made?
If you are going through a dealer, it might take anywhere from 30 minutes to a couple of hours. Locksmiths can sometimes offer quicker service, especially if they pertain to you.
3. Is programming constantly required for a spare key?
Not constantly. Standard keys do not require shows, while transponder and wise keys should be configured to match the car's security system.
